14 Aerodynamic Blade Design Challenges Design of 2D profiles 3D blades Advanced turbulence modeling: Flow separations Laminar to turbulent transition Roughness effects Tip vortices Scale resolving simulation (LES, SAS ) Interaction with upstream turbines Design studies & optimization Photo José Luis Gutiérrez, graphic courtesy of IMPSA S.A., Argentina - 13 / 22 -
15 Nacelle / Tower Base Cooling Challenges Ensure effective cooling under all environmental conditions Complex geometries & many details Many parameters: Fan positions & number Positions of electrical devices Outside temperature & incoming sun radiation Courtesy of GAMESA Benefits of simulations Virtual prototyping of different cooling solutions Less trial & error Reduce thermal peak loads on generator, gear, transformer, etc. Pre-identify problem regions - 14 / 22 -
16 Wind Park Design & Site Selection Challenges Steep terrain, mountains, forests Predict wind behavior & turbulences Varying wind directions and speeds Benefits of simulations Power estimates Optimize turbine placement Wind speed & turbulence prediction over complex terrain - 15 / 22 -
